Kaukonde booted out

MASHONALAND East Zanu-PF provincial chairperson Ray Kaukonde was yesterday booted out through a vote of no confidence passed on him and some members of his executive, becoming the eighth provincal chair to face the same fate.Cde Phineas Chihota has been appointed acting chairperson.

The other Zanu-PF provincial chairpersons kicked out in recent weeks are Cdes Temba Mliswa (Mashonaland West), Callisto Gwanetsa (Masvingo), Jason Machaya (Midlands), Amos Midzi (Harare), Andrew Langa (Matabeleland South), Professor Callistus Ndlovu (Bulawayo) and John Mvundura (Manicaland).

Cde Chihota yesterday said 27 members of the provincial executive out of 50 voted for the ouster of Cde Kaukonde and seven other members of his executive.

“The members of the executive passed the vote of no confidence on Cde Kaukonde because they doubted his sincerity in terms of driving programmes while he was also working against the party by fanning factionalism,” he said.

“He was also taking advantage of other people including women in implementation of programmes as well as practising individualism.”

The members of his executive also booted out were political commissar Cde Tendai Makunde and his deputy Cde George Katsande, deputy secretary for security Cde Washington Musvaire, deputy secretary for finance Cde Felix Mhona, secretary for education Cde Taurai Pasirai, secretary for administration Cde Peter Murwira and Cde Boniface Mutize.

Last week, war veterans, youths and women attempted to pass a vote of no confidence against Cde Kaukonde after a demonstration in Marondera, but their move was of no effect as it was not constitutional.

The move only had the effect of leaving Cde Kaukonde on the brink as the war veterans led a push to kick him out, but he could only be ousted if the Provincial Executive Council passed the vote of no confidence in his leadership according to the party’s constitution.

The appropriate organ to pass the vote of no confidence in Cde Kaukonde was the provincial executive council.

Cde Kaukonde was identified by First Lady Cde Grace Mugabe as the financial kingpin of a plot led by Vice President Joice Mujuru to oust President Mugabe.

The First Lady said Cde Kaukonde was wearing a fake smile for the First Family when he was at the forefront of denigrating the President.

There has been simmering anger from Zanu-PF members in the province from the Women’s League, the Youth League, the main wing and war veterans against Cde Kaukonde following revelations that he was supporting efforts to oust President Mugabe.
